Facts about How Important Can It Be

✔️

Who wrote How Important Can It Be lyrics?


How Important Can It Be is written by George David Weiss, Bennie Benjamin.
✔️

When was How Important Can It Be released?


It is first released in 1963 as part of Wanda Jackson's album "Love Me Forever" which includes 12 tracks in total.
✔️

Which genre is How Important Can It Be?


How Important Can It Be falls under the genre Country.
✔️

How long is the song How Important Can It Be?


How Important Can It Be song length is 2 minutes and 40 seconds.
